CRYSTAL STRUCTURE AND THERMAL STABILITY OF NEW IRON PHOSPHATES KMFe(PO4)2 (M = Ni, Mg, and Co)
Abstract:Three isostructural iron monophosphates KNiFe(PO 4) 2 (KNi), KMgFe(PO 4) 2 (KMg-LT, where LT means ″low-temperature stable phase″), and KCoFe(PO 4) 2 (KCo-LT) are synthesized and structurally characterized from X-ray diffraction data. They crystallize in the monoclinic system with the space group P2 1 /c.
